User-Agent: Mozilla/5.0 (X11; U; Linux i686; en-US; rv:1.9a1) Gecko/20050814 SeaMonkey/1.0a Build Identifier: Mozilla/5.0 (X11; U; Linux i686; en-US; rv:1.9a1) Gecko/20050814 SeaMonkey/1.0a This is very strange. When I start Seamonkey without the profile selection dialog came first, the widgets like Button, Radio, looks bad: there's NO TEXT display on them. BTW, I mean the buttons on web page, not UI. I compile the newest Seamonkey code every day, and this problem has came for almost one week. And my debian built Mozilla 1.7.10 also has the same problem?! Reproducible: Always Steps to Reproduce: 1. Start Seamonkey without profile selection dialog, It has the problem every time 2. Click Tools=>Switch Profile... and ensure the "Don't ask at startup" checkbox is unchecked, then quit. 3. Start Seamonkey again, no problem I'm using Debian unstable, I compile Seamonkey myself.
